Discovering Venice’s Rich History

Founded more than 1,500 years ago, Venice has a long and storied history that is reflected in its architecture and culture. The city’s strategic location made it a major center of trade and commerce during the Middle Ages, leading to its prosperity and growth. Venice became a powerful maritime republic, known for its naval prowess and influence in the Mediterranean region.

The Architectural Marvels of Venice

One of the most striking features of Venice is its unique architecture, which reflects a blend of Byzantine, Gothic, and Renaissance styles. The city is home to numerous architectural marvels, including the iconic St. Mark’s Basilica, a stunning example of Byzantine architecture with its intricate mosaics and domes.

The Cultural Heritage of Venice

Venice has a rich cultural heritage that is evident in its art, music, and cuisine. The city was home to many renowned artists, including Titian, Tintoretto, and Canaletto, whose works can be admired in the city’s museums and churches. Venice is also known for its vibrant music scene, with regular performances of classical music and opera.

Venice’s Unique Festivals and Traditions

Venice is famous for its colorful festivals and traditions, which showcase the city’s unique culture and history. The Venice Carnival, held annually before Lent, is one of the most famous carnivals in the world, known for its elaborate masks and costumes. The Venice Biennale, an international art exhibition held every two years, attracts artists and art enthusiasts from around the globe.
